Williams’ Alex Albon is out of F1 Canadian Grand Prix sprint qualifying after hitting an animal on track in practice

Alex Albon has been ruled out of Friday’s sprint qualifying session at the Canadian Grand Prix after hitting a marmot and the outside wall on Turns 6 and 7, causing extensive damage to the car.

Williams confirmed that the damage was too severe to repair in time, leading to Albon missing the session.

Liam Lawson of Racing Bulls also missed sprint qualifying due to a hydraulic leak issue that couldn’t be fixed in time.

Racing Bulls were fined €30,000 for the incident involving Lawson’s car, with €20,000 of the fine suspended for 12 months.

Both teams are focusing on repairing the cars to be ready for the upcoming sessions.
